Transforming Ordinary Items into Educational Tools
Learning doesn't always need to happen within the confines of a textbook or classroom. Engaging learners through everyday items can spark curiosity and make education more relevant. A simple fork can become a tool for exploring balance, while a household clock introduces concepts of elapsed moments. By adapting common objects, educators can create engaging learning experiences that resonate with students.

Harnessing the Impact of Props
Incorporating teaching aids into learning activities can significantly enhance student engagement and comprehension. A tangible object can serve as a powerful instrument for representing abstract concepts, making learning more tangible. For example, using a map to teach about geography or manipulatives to illustrate mathematical principles can provide students with a hands-on learning experience that deepens their understanding.
- Additionally, props can fuel curiosity and inspire discussion among students.
- They can also appeal to different learning preferences, making instruction more accessible.
By strategically incorporate props, educators can enrich the learning environment and facilitate deeper student engagement.
